Listed by PRD BallaratNestled in the heart of Mount Pleasant, 416 Gladstone Street this four-bedroom, two-bathroom brick home that combines comfort, convenience, and charm. Perfectly suited for family living, this property is an inviting blend of modern functionality and timeless style.
Key Features:
• Four Spacious Bedrooms: Each bedroom offers ample space and is fitted with built-in robes, providing practical storage solutions for the whole family. The master bedroom includes an en-suite, ensuring added privacy and convenience.
• Two Well-Appointed Bathrooms: Featuring a main family bathroom and an en-suite for the master, the home is designed to meet the demands of busy family life, offering convenience and comfort.
• Open-Plan Living & Dining: The expansive living and dining areas create a bright, welcoming space perfect for entertaining or relaxing. Elegant flooring and abundant natural light enhance the room's warmth and appeal.
• Outdoor Deck: Step from the dining room onto the deck, an ideal spot for alfresco dining, unwinding after a long day, or enjoying the outdoors. Overlooking a large backyard, this space is ideal for entertaining family and friends.
• Generously Sized Kitchen: Well-equipped with modern appliances, ample counter space, and abundant storage, the kitchen is designed to make meal preparation easy. It flows seamlessly into the dining area, making it perfect for family meals and gatherings.
• Expansive Block - Approx. 899m²: Set on a generous block, this property offers plenty of outdoor space for children's play, gardening, or future expansion (subject to council approval). With well-maintained lawns and a secure yard, you'll have peace of mind and room to grow.
• Double Garage & Shed: The spacious two-car garage provides secure parking and extra storage space. A large shed in the backyard offers even more room for tools, equipment, or a workshop, ideal for those who enjoy DIY projects.
• Prime Location: Located in a friendly, family-oriented neighborhood, this home is close to local schools, parks, public transport, and shopping amenities, placing everything you need right at your doorstep.
416 Gladstone Street presents a fantastic opportunity for buyers seeking a spacious, well-maintained family home in one of Mount Pleasant's most sought-after areas. Don't miss your chance to secure this beautiful property at the attractive price of $639,000.
